Afghanistan Army 2531 soldiers killed, 4238 wounded in four months

KABUL - A total of 2,531 Afghan security forces were killed and 4,238 wounded in the first four months of the year, according to figures released in a report by the Special Inspector General for Afghanistan, a U.S. Congressional watchdog.

The figures, from Jan. 1-May 8, were provided to U.S. military authorities by the Afghan government and were consistent with figures from the same period last year, the report said.
